The Science Behind Warm Milk's Soothing Effects

For generations, a glass of warm milk has been a classic remedy for a restless night, and this tradition is rooted in both science and psychology. Beyond being a comforting ritual, several components of milk contribute to its effects. Milk contains tryptophan, an amino acid that plays a role in the production of serotonin, a neurotransmitter that boosts mood and promotes relaxation. Serotonin, in turn, is a precursor to melatonin, the hormone that regulates your sleep-wake cycle. While the amount of tryptophan in a single glass of milk is relatively small, it contributes to the sleep-promoting cocktail found in milk. The psychological effect of a soothing, warm beverage as part of a consistent bedtime routine also plays a significant role in signaling to your brain that it is time to wind down.

Warm Milk and Sleep

Studies suggest that warm milk can help improve sleep quality, particularly when consumed as part of a relaxing nightly ritual. The warmth of the liquid can have a calming effect on the nervous system, which may be more effective for lulling you to sleep than a cold drink. One study even found improved sleep quality in hospital patients who were given warm milk with honey for three consecutive nights. The combination of the sleep-regulating compounds in milk and the comforting psychological effect can be a powerful aid for those who struggle to fall asleep.

Warm Milk and Digestion

When it comes to digestion, the temperature of milk can make a notable difference. Many people find warm milk easier to digest than cold milk, especially those with sensitive stomachs. This is because the warmth helps relax the digestive tract, potentially easing discomfort and reducing symptoms like bloating or gas. Research has shown that heating milk causes its proteins to coagulate faster in the stomach, which aids the digestive enzyme pepsin in breaking down the milk more efficiently. However, it is important to note that milk should be consumed alone for best digestion, particularly in the evening, according to Ayurvedic practices. For individuals with lactose sensitivity, warm milk may still cause issues, though some find it better tolerated than cold milk. For those with milk protein allergies or severe lactose intolerance, boiling the milk can alter the structure of some proteins and lactose, making it easier to digest, but this is not a guaranteed remedy and should be approached with caution.

Warm Milk vs. Cold Milk: A Comparison

While both warm and cold milk offer the same core nutrients, such as calcium, protein, and vitamins, their effects on the body differ based on temperature.

Feature Warm Milk Cold Milk
Digestion Easier for many, as heat promotes faster protein coagulation and soothes the digestive tract. May be harder to digest for some individuals with sensitive stomachs, potentially causing gas or bloating.
Sleep Promotion Can promote relaxation due to a calming effect on the nervous system and the psychological comfort of a warm beverage. Less effective for inducing relaxation and sleep, as it lacks the soothing physical sensation.
Acidity Relief Not ideal for those with acid reflux, as the fat can relax the oesophagal sphincter. Provides temporary relief from heartburn and acidity by neutralizing excess stomach acid.
Energy Boost Provides steady nourishment and can be more filling, which may help prevent night cravings. Offers a refreshing and quick energy boost, especially beneficial during hot weather.
Nutrient Absorption Heat can slightly alter milk proteins, potentially reducing the absorption of certain vitamins like B12. Retains more of the original nutrient profile, particularly heat-sensitive vitamins.

Potential Downsides and Considerations

While warm milk has many positive effects, there are a few considerations to keep in mind. For those with lactose intolerance, consuming milk at any temperature can cause digestive issues, though some report fewer symptoms with warm milk. Drinking milk on an empty stomach, particularly warm milk, has been linked to potential issues like blood sugar fluctuations and poor nutrient absorption of other foods later in the day, according to some traditional viewpoints. Individuals with a history of acid reflux may also find warm milk problematic, as the fat content can relax the lower oesophageal sphincter. Additionally, while a single glass of milk is not a significant calorie source, overconsumption can contribute to weight gain if it adds to an already high-calorie diet.
